When trying to deploy deployment containing following two EJBs, secured and unsecured, deploying fails with "Multiple security domains not supported" exception:

Caused by: org.jboss.as.server.deployment.DeploymentUnitProcessingException: WFLYEJB0490: Multiple security domains not supported

This behavior was in JBEAP-9289 considered correct for situation when one EJB references one security domain and the second references second security domain.
It seems unsecured EJB is considered to be using default security domain.

*Workaround:* Need to set unsecured bean secured by adding:
{code}
@PermitAll
@SecurityDomain("other2") // the same as for secured ejb
{code}
